Output 6650184dd5ac251c55edf0de836d78c63454f73e0e4b44b45a6ffbce8e596ec3:0

value
7596364
script pubkey
OP_0 OP_PUSHBYTES_20 deef754860344f59a9ac523b69829677ffdeffcb
address
bc1qmmhh2jrqx384n2dv2gaknq5kwllaal7tcsljwg
transaction
6650184dd5ac251c55edf0de836d78c63454f73e0e4b44b45a6ffbce8e596ec3
spent
true